The End of Document-Upload KYC
The traditional model of customer onboarding, in which every new financial relationship requires uploading identity documents, completing liveness checks, and waiting for manual review, is approaching obsolescence. In 2026, the convergence of reusable digital credentials, decentralised identity frameworks, and regulatory mandates is creating a new paradigm in which verified identity information travels with the customer rather than being reconstructed at every touchpoint.
This shift is not merely an efficiency improvement. It represents a fundamental redesign of the trust architecture that underpins financial services, with profound implications for fraud prevention, regulatory compliance, and customer experience.
The Rise of Verifiable Credentials
Verifiable credentials, cryptographically signed attestations of identity attributes issued by trusted parties, enable individuals to prove facts about themselves without exposing underlying personal data. A customer who has been verified by one institution can present a credential to another, which can validate its authenticity and integrity without needing to repeat the verification process.
Zero-knowledge proof technology takes this further, allowing individuals to prove specific attributes, such as being over eighteen or resident in a particular jurisdiction, without revealing the underlying data. This addresses the privacy paradox that has long plagued financial services: the need to know enough about customers to manage risk while collecting as little personal data as possible.
Regulatory Tailwinds
The EU's eIDAS 2.0 regulation requires Member States to provide digital identity wallets to citizens by December 2026, creating a standardised framework for cross-border identity verification. This regulatory mandate is expected to drive rapid adoption of reusable credentials across European financial services and establish a model that other jurisdictions may follow.
In parallel, FATF guidance on digital identity has established a framework for when and how digital identity solutions can satisfy customer due diligence requirements, providing the regulatory clarity that institutions need to invest in these technologies with confidence.
Implications for Fraud Prevention
Reusable credentials and decentralised identity frameworks also offer significant fraud prevention benefits. By anchoring identity to cryptographic proofs rather than easily replicated documents, these systems make synthetic identity fraud substantially more difficult. An attacker cannot fabricate a verifiable credential without access to the issuing authority's signing keys.
However, the transition period creates new risks. As institutions adopt different identity verification standards and technologies, gaps between legacy and modern systems may be exploited. Deepfake-generated identity documents and liveness spoofing remain threats that must be addressed through advanced presentation attack detection and multi-modal verification.
Strategic Priorities for Financial Institutions
Institutions should begin evaluating their readiness for credential-based onboarding now. This includes assessing whether current technology platforms can accept and validate verifiable credentials, understanding the regulatory requirements in each operating jurisdiction, and developing strategies for the transition period in which both traditional and credential-based verification must be supported.
The institutions that lead this transition will benefit from reduced onboarding friction, lower verification costs, and stronger fraud prevention, while those that lag will face increasing competitive disadvantage and potential regulatory pressure as digital identity frameworks become the expected standard.
